Output 96ac4268aa64fc4e0fe3df9282f02dcc656034bf5f73ce7ce1edeb0dc2d33707:1

value
999387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c738a8f92ffa4edee98a8aaa0eeb9ad58e1082 OP_EQUAL
address
3MBNWYWvYP9TGgBbXqNm6jATDL9EttfBT8
transaction
96ac4268aa64fc4e0fe3df9282f02dcc656034bf5f73ce7ce1edeb0dc2d33707
confirmations
292551
spent
true